Report: C:\Program Files\Solomon\Usr_Rpts\CUSTOM.RPT Crystal Print Engine Error: 723 - Error in File C:\Program Files\Solomon\Usr_Rpts\CUSTOM.RPT: Failed to open a rowset....check to make sure you have set the correct permissions for access to your custom view, table, or stored procedure.You can run this SQL script (make sure you have proper backups in case you make an error) to set the permissions correctly after you change the object name to the name of your custom view, table, or stored procedure and change the long user name shown in the first line of the script.--I removed some the middle charactors
